Question on: WAEC Agriculture - 2016

Crop rotation is often used in maintaining soil fertility because

A
all crops grown, add nutrient to the soil
B
some of the crops fix nitrogen in the soil
C
crops grown are ploughed into the soil
D
the crops are rotated on different farmlands
Ask EduPadi AI for a detailed answer
Correct Option: B
